About Mcelvain School
McElvain School is a small public school located in Murphysboro, Illinois, in Jackson County. Serving only the pre-kindergarten level, McElvain has an enrollment of 80 students and one full-time equivalent teacher, resulting in a very high student-teacher ratio of 80:1. The school’s setting is in a rural area near the town, offering a close-knit community atmosphere.
While academic test score data is not available to provide detailed performance metrics, McElvain School operates within a framework focusing on early childhood development and nurturing young learners. Situated in a quiet rural location, it offers students a peaceful environment conducive to learning and growth.
What Parents Should Know
With an enrollment of 80 students, Mcelvain School is a smaller school where families often find a close-knit community atmosphere. Smaller settings can mean more individual attention from teachers and staff, though they may offer fewer extracurricular options than larger schools.
The student-teacher ratio at Mcelvain School is 80:1, which is higher than the national average. This may mean larger class sizes, so parents should ask about classroom support, teaching assistants, and how the school differentiates instruction for students who need extra help.
Located in a rural area, Mcelvain School may involve longer commutes for some families. Rural schools often serve as community anchors and may have smaller class sizes, but parents should consider transportation logistics, after-school program availability, and access to specialized services.
